Just returned from Oasis. The package included all frozen virgin drinks and all specialty coffees without spirits. (Not Starbucks). As well it included sparkling water such as San Pellegrino, fresh squeezed juice, bottled water at all bars, and of course freestyle sodas etc. very good value for us. Although some of the staff were not 100 percent familiar apparently when they swipe your sea pass it zeroes out the price of included beverages and credits the gratuity to them so it works well. And staff were pretty helpful overall. Also in many cases it is less money if you buy virgin drink and add a shot yourself, ie Piña Coladas saved a dollar. However, you'd have to drink a whole lot to make the Ultimate package worthwhile in my opinion.

There is no limit on the time to wait just that you can only get one drink at a time. No limits on quantity. I had Royal Replenish and got bottled water, or sparking water with each drink or glass of water I purchased. The bottled water included is the 16 oz size, not the large bottles in the mini-bat/water package. Brand varies by ship/availability. You can order specialty coffee, water etc. any where they are available (MDR, Bars, Specialty restaurants) except Starbucks which is not included.
